The Rise of Next.js

Next.js has been gaining momentum in the web development ecosystem, and for good reasons. It provides a robust foundation for building modern web applications that are optimized for performance, SEO, and developer experience. Here are some key highlights of Next.js:

1. Server-Side Rendering (SSR)

One of the standout features of Next.js is its built-in support for server-side rendering. With SSR, your web application can generate dynamic content on the server and send a fully rendered page to the client, resulting in faster page loads and improved SEO. No need to rely solely on client-side rendering, which can slow down initial page rendering.

2. Automatic Code Splitting

Next.js excels in optimizing your app's performance by automatically splitting your JavaScript bundles. This means that only the necessary code is loaded when a user navigates to a specific page, reducing initial loading times and saving bandwidth.

3. SEO-Friendly

Search Engine Optimization is a critical factor for the success of any web application. Next.js takes care of SEO best practices by providing server-rendered pages, structured metadata, and canonical URLs out of the box. This helps your app rank higher in search engine results, increasing its visibility.

4. Developer Experience

Next.js simplifies development with features like hot module reloading, error reporting, and a friendly developer environment. Its file-based routing system is intuitive, making it easy to organize and manage your application's routes.

Building a Next.js App

Now, let's dive into building a simple Next.js application to get a taste of its power. We'll create a basic blog website with server-rendered pages and dynamic routing.

Step 1: Setting Up Your Environment

To get started with Next.js, ensure you have Node.js and npm (or yarn) installed on your machine. Then, create a new Next.js project:

npx create-next-app my-blog
cd my-blog
npm run dev

This sets up a new Next.js project with the development server running.

Step 2: Creating Pages

Next.js follows a convention where files inside the pages directory automatically become routes. Create a pages/blog directory and add an index.js file to it. This will be our blog's homepage:

// pages/blog/index.js

export default function Blog() {
  return (
    <div>
      <h1>Welcome to My Blog</h1>
      {/* Your blog posts will go here */}
    </div>
  )
}

Step 3: Adding Dynamic Routes

Let's make our blog more dynamic by adding individual post pages. Create a pages/blog/[slug].js file for this:

// pages/blog/[slug].js

import { useRouter } from 'next/router'

export default function BlogPost() {
  const router = useRouter()
  const { slug } = router.query

  return (
    <div>
      <h1>Blog Post: {slug}</h1>
      {/* Display the blog post content here */}
    </div>
  )
}

Now, any URL like /blog/hello-world will automatically render this page with the slug parameter.

Step 4: Fetching Data

You can fetch data for your blog posts from an API, a CMS, or a local source. For simplicity, let's fetch a list of blog post titles from a local JSON file. Create a data directory at the root of your project and add a blog-posts.json file:

// data/blog-posts.json

[
  { "slug": "hello-world", "title": "Hello, World!" },
  { "slug": "next-js-rocks", "title": "Why Next.js Rocks" }
]

Now, modify your pages/blog/index.js to fetch and display these posts:

// pages/blog/index.js

import Link from 'next/link'
import { useEffect, useState } from 'react'

export default function Blog() {
  const [posts, setPosts] = useState([])

  useEffect(() => {
    fetch('/data/blog-posts.json')
      .then((response) => response.json())
      .then((data) => setPosts(data))
  }, [])

  return (
    <div>
      <h1>Welcome to My Blog</h1>
      <ul>
        {posts.map((post) => (
          <li key={post.slug}>
            <Link href={`/blog/${post.slug}`}>
              <a>{post.title}</a>
            </Link>
          </li>
        ))}
      </ul>
    </div>
  )
}

You now have a basic blog website with server-rendered pages and dynamic routing powered by Next.js!
